Roast Goose (25th December) Goose was always the number one festive food for celebrations such as weddings and Michaelmas which were held between September and Christmas. Stuffed with herbs and fruit, it used to be boiled but by the 19th century it was roasted, stuffed with onions, bacons and potatoes, or with apples and potatoes.

Roast Goose Or Turkey Like the US, Ireland has adopted the 16th-century English tradition of serving roast turkey for Christmas dinner. However, those who don't care for it substitute other kinds of poultry, such as roast goose - the dish that was most common on Irish Christmas tables before the arrival of the turkey.
